Output 1705be211ddfbfb8bf5fa9eb69469d1b6035904a7b919e93efa00540b4f0a794:130

value
8667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e057532ec3c352eebbf4ce38af2b06ceb653d4c OP_EQUAL
address
35tMYamsL7meW53MAAVpwzhvxseeqkBk3P
transaction
1705be211ddfbfb8bf5fa9eb69469d1b6035904a7b919e93efa00540b4f0a794
confirmations
169279
spent
true